Old Days dives into the making of Park Chan-wook's Oldboy, offering a fascinating glimpse behind the curtain. The pacing is reflective, allowing you to really soak in the thoughts and insights shared by those involved. It's shot with a straightforward yet engaging style, and it doesn't shy away from discussing the film's darker themes and complex character motivations. The atmosphere is almost reverent, treating Oldboy with the weight it deserves. Practical effects and raw performances get highlighted, showcasing the artistry behind what many consider a landmark film. It's not just a typical documentary; it’s a love letter to the craft and a peek into the creative process that shaped something so potent.
